titleOfInvention Galvanized steel sheet with excellent corrosion resistance and lubricity
abstract (57) [Problem] To provide a galvanized steel sheet having excellent corrosion resistance and lubrication properties. SOLUTION: On a surface of a zinc-based plated steel sheet, a film made of a mercaptide compound which is a reaction product of a thiol compound of the following (a) and (b) with a part of a zinc-based plating film, or a film of the following (a) and / Or the thiol compound of (b) and the following A zinc-based plated steel sheet having a film made of a mercaptide compound which is a reaction product of the thiol compound of (a) and (b) with a part of the zinc-based plating film. (a) an alkylthiol compound having a thiol group at the terminal or at both ends of a linear alkyl group having 8 or more carbon atoms (b) trithiocyanuric acid
